Quick Verdict

Winner: ViewSonic Elite XG270QG 27-inch QHD Monitor

Offers better resolution and value for its price, making it suitable for a wider range of applications beyond just gaming.

Key Differences

  • Resolution: The ViewSonic offers a higher QHD resolution (2560 x 1440) compared to the Alienware's Full HD (1920 x 1080).
  • Refresh Rate: Alienware boasts a higher refresh rate of 360Hz, significantly surpassing ViewSonic's 165Hz.
  • Price: The ViewSonic is significantly more affordable, making it accessible to a broader audience.

Design & Build

The Alienware AW2521H is lighter and has a more futuristic design, appealing to gamers who value aesthetics and desk space. In contrast, the ViewSonic Elite XG270QG, though heavier, offers a larger screen size and a more professional look, making it suitable for both gaming and work environments. Both monitors have VESA mount compatibility, catering to users preferring wall-mounted setups.

Performance

Performance-wise, the Alienware's higher refresh rate translates to smoother gameplay, crucial for competitive gaming. However, the ViewSonic's higher resolution provides sharper images, enhancing the overall viewing experience for gaming and professional use. Both monitors have a 1ms response time, ensuring minimal input lag.

Features

  • Alienware AW2521H 24.5-inch Full HD Monitor: Stands out with its unparalleled 360Hz refresh rate and NVIDIA G-SYNC for tear-free gaming.
  • ViewSonic Elite XG270QG 27-inch QHD Monitor: Offers a higher resolution for clearer images and a wider color gamut (98% DCI-P3), enhancing color accuracy for professional use.

Best For

Alienware AW2521H 24.5-inch Full HD Monitor: Competitive gamers who prioritize refresh rate and response time for an edge in fast-paced games.

ViewSonic Elite XG270QG 27-inch QHD Monitor: Users seeking a balance between gaming performance and high-quality visuals for professional applications.

Value Analysis

While the Alienware monitor offers cutting-edge refresh rates, its higher price tag and lower resolution limit its versatility. The ViewSonic, on the other hand, provides a better price-to-performance ratio, offering high resolution, decent refresh rates, and a broader color spectrum at a significantly lower cost.

Final Recommendation

Considering the overall performance, features, and value, the ViewSonic Elite XG270QG 27-inch QHD Monitor is the recommended choice for most users. It strikes an excellent balance between gaming needs and professional use, making it a versatile option at a more accessible price point.
